It’s an arena for boys and girls aged U6 (2020) through U19 (2007) to test their progress, push boundaries, and chase down glory beneath a California sky.
The Details:
The Showcase will follow the 2025–2026 season age groupings
Entry fees are tiered by age:
U6–U10: $650
U11–U12: $725
U13–U19: $850
This event is unrestricted—open to any team in good standing with a U.S. Soccer Federation affiliate. Sanctioned by US Club Soccer, the tournament welcomes a wide array of teams from a multitude of leagues and backgrounds.
